These files are typically re-encoded into highly compressed containers (like using x264 or x265 codecs). This reduces a massive 4GB HD file into a manageable 300MB to 700MB file , making it incredibly popular in regions with limited broadband access or expensive mobile data. How Movie Repacking Works
